Default Cat bypass quetions

I have a C8 with the performance exhaust. It's too quiet for my liking since I came from a F Type R. I've been deliberating between sport cats and cat-bypass for some time and have decided to go with cat-bypass pipes from 2M. Mostly because I've never had a straight piped car and my allocation will be coming up for the Z06 in about a year so I figured I'd just go for it since it's just a year to try it out. Also we don't do emissions in Florida.

Questions I have for those that have done this:
1. Which gaskets did you go with? I've read the 2M gaskets are pretty terrible. If you did the OEM ones, what's the part number? I can't find it anywhere
2. These don't come with the O2 spacer/mini cat correct? You need to buy it separately? I reached out to 2M a week ago and it's been radio silence
3. If I need to buy O2 spacer/mini cat separately, which one do you recommend? The one from 2M? Or is there a better one?
4. What has been everyone's experience with these with CELs? I read that you *shouldn't* get a CEL if you use O2 spacer/mini cat but it would be reassuring to hear people comment that have had them for some time.

Appreciate it. Looking to order these Monday to liven up the exhaust.

See below for a write-up I did on this already with their cat deletes but I'll answer your questions as best I can from memory:

1.) Listed in my link below
2.) They do come with the cat delete pipes from 2M. It's even listed on their website on the page for them. The reason it's been radio silent is because their customer support gets hammered by people asking questions that are easily found either on the product page or in the FAQ on their site.
3.) See #2
4.) I've had their cat deletes/o2 spacers for over 5000 miles and have never had a CEL come on.

I'd recommend going with the cat deletes instead of the sport cats. It'll be the best sounding/loudest and less weight in the car.
